flutter pub get速度慢
原因: 防火墙问题,不允许访问**
解决方法:设置系统环境中设置
FLUTTER_STORAGE_BASE_URL
----- https
://storage
.flutter
-io
.cn
PUB_HOSTED_URL
------ https
://pub
.flutter
-io
.cn
版本问题
场景: 拿到一个新的Flutter项目,更新完插件,运行项目抱错
Error
: The method
'DioHttpHeaders.add' has fewer named arguments than those
原因: Flutter 本地版本过高 ,并对于http请求的dio包 有最低版本需求,dio: 3.0.0起步,有些语法不存在导致项目无法运行 和 打包
解决方法:修改 pubspec.yaml 文件种 dio 版本 ^3.0.9 ,重新更新包,并重启项目。